As I stated at our meeting, we are only seeking approval for the highway works relating to the A41 junction within this application. The application submitted accords with the In-Principle highway works plan (1546/GA/902) of the Section 106 Agreement. As far as we are concerned the "gateway entrances" symbol on the Parameters Plan within the Design Code relates to the broader treatment of the entrance to the site, and does not require anything specific within the highway land itself. The symbol should not be read as requiring a gateway feature within the centre of the highway or within highway land. The gateway will be formed by appropriate development frontages onto the highway, landmark buildings (see table page 112, landmark C) within development plots and appropriate landscaping in front of buildings as required by the Design Code. Those development plots will of course require reserved matters approval, where compliance with the Design Code will be required, otherwise you can of course refuse planning permission. Landscaping will be required in front of the commercial buildings as indicated on figure 4.28 (Section X-X) of the Design Code (page 151), so combined with existing/improved landscaping to the boundaries of the site with the A41, there will be adequate landscaping adjacent to this gateway. Road surfacing (Primary Street) is defined within the Code (mandatory) see table 3.15 (page 53) and "streetscape" table page 114. We will submit, in due course a landscape scheme for the public right of way which crosses the spine road in this location, as part of the structural landscape scheme for the areas adjacent to the education campus (area SL21; refer to my letter to Jenny dated 17 December, plan drawing number DFD/BIC/SL/L1). There would be adequate space within the landscape area adjacent to this junction to provide for a landscape feature and/or public art if appropriate. Such a scheme will not be ready however prior to your deadline for determination of this matter. This matter should not however hold up determination of the current application. With the above in mind, we would be pleased if you could determine the application as submitted, as we do not consider the application contrary to the requirements of the Design Code.
